Brit Care Mini Puppy Lamb Dry Dog Food
Brit Care Mini Puppy Lamb is a premium dry dog food specifically formulated to meet the nutritional needs of puppies belonging to small and miniature breeds. This balanced recipe features high-quality lamb as the primary protein source, ensuring excellent digestibility and providing the essential amino acids required for healthy muscle development during the rapid growth phase of a puppy's life. The formula is carefully crafted to support the immune system and overall vitality, helping your young dog thrive during its most critical developmental stages.
The primary benefit of this food lies in its hypoallergenic lamb-based composition, which is gentle on sensitive digestive systems and reduces the risk of food intolerances. The kibble size is specifically adapted for the smaller jaws of miniature breeds, promoting easier chewing and better oral hygiene. Furthermore, the inclusion of balanced minerals and vitamins supports strong bone and joint development, which is vital for small dogs that are highly active. The recipe is free from common allergens like wheat, soy, and corn, ensuring a clean and nutritious diet for your growing pet.
This product is not intended for large or giant breed puppies, as their specific growth requirements and caloric needs differ significantly from those of small breeds. Additionally, it may not be suitable for dogs with a diagnosed allergy specifically to lamb protein.
To transition your puppy to Brit Care Mini Puppy Lamb, it is recommended to introduce the new food gradually over a period of seven to ten days. Start by mixing a small amount of the new food with the previous diet, slowly increasing the proportion of the new food while decreasing the old. Ensure that fresh, clean drinking water is always available to your puppy throughout the day. The daily feeding amount should be adjusted based on your puppy's age, activity level, and overall body condition as advised by your veterinarian.
Always monitor your puppy's weight and body condition to prevent overfeeding, and consult your veterinarian to establish a feeding schedule that supports healthy, steady growth.
